Jack Burton didn’t die from smoking - he died from not smoking for just three days whilst he was on holiday. Read that sentence again.
A 29-year-old man died after stopping smoking. Not because smoking caused lung disease or cancer or pneumonia. Not because nicotine withdrawal harmed him. He died because stopping smoking caused the level of his prescribed antipsychotic medication, Clozapine, to rise to toxic levels. He stopped smoking for three days, and died on the fourth.

The risk most people have never heard of
For people taking certain so-called ‘antipsychotic medications’ (namely Clozapine and Olanzapine - although there are a few others so please look for up for yourself if you are taking antipsychotics), cigarette smoking is an extremely important risk factor. It completely changes how the medication behaves inside the body.
The chemicals produced by the burning tobacco increase the activity of a liver enzyme responsible for breaking down medications such as clozapine and olanzapine. This means many people who smoke ‘require’ higher doses than people who do not. When someone stops smoking or even reduces smoking temporarily, that effect begins to disappear. The medication is no longer broken down as quickly. Blood levels of toxic antipsychotics can rise dramatically within days causing severe side effects.
In some cases, as the tragic death of Jack Burton demonstrates, those levels can become fatal. He was taking 525mg of Clozapine, stopped smoking for three days due to being on holiday, and then died from the toxicity in his blood.
This is not because of nicotine. It is because of the tobacco smoke itself.

This raises so many questions for me, as the most common symptoms of the antipsychotic toxicity rising due to reducing tobacco even over a couple of days include:
dizziness
confusion
seizures (especially with clozapine)
toxicity
feelings of severe drowsiness or sedation
Conversely, if someone then starts smoking more again a couple of days later, the medication may become ‘less effective’ because the body clears it more quickly - and so the person could be experiencing an absolute rollercoaster of medication side effects purely based on how many cigarettes they have been having recently.

The coroner’s concerns should concern us all
Following this young man’s death, the coroner issued a Prevention of Future Deaths report. What I found particularly striking was not only the tragedy itself, but the concerns raised afterwards.
The report describes inconsistent accounts from his consultant psychiatrists about their understanding of the relationship between smoking and clozapine, and raises concerns about whether there are sufficiently standardised systems to identify and respond when patients change their smoking habits.
This probably annoyed me the most - that even in the event of a death - the coroner got inconsistent and conflicting accounts from the psychiatrists about their understanding of the impact of smoking on the antipsychotics they prescribe. It speaks volumes.
And then for the coroner to state that there is no national guidance on this, no frameworks and no practice guidance for any of this relationship between smoking and antipsychotic use is absolutely appalling considering how clearly deadly this is.
Because this is not an obscure interaction affecting a handful of people - we cannot argue that this risk is rare. Smoking has long been recognised as being substantially more common among people diagnosed with mental disorders such as ‘psychosis’ and ‘schizophrenia’ than in the general population, with many studies reporting rates of around 60-80% (Leon et al. 2005).
That means a large proportion of people prescribed clozapine are likely to smoke. And many of them will, at some point, try to cut down. Or stop altogether - because there are endless public health campaigns encouraging everyone to stop smoking.
